/* @override http://africanpalacecasino.com.dedi103.your-server.de/styles.css */

/* @group General */

body {
	margin-top:0px;
	color: white;
	font: 10pt "Lucida Grande", Arial, sans-serif;
	top: 20px;
	background: #0a3d07 url(./img/bkgtile.png) repeat-x left top;
}

body p{
	font: 8pt "Lucida Grande", Arial, sans-serif;
}

.generaltext{
	font: 8pt "Lucida Grande", Arial, sans-serif;
}

a {
	border-style: none;
}

a:link { color: #FFCC00; text-decoration: none}

a:visited { color: #FFCC00; text-decoration: none}

a:hover { color: #FFCC00; text-decoration: underline}

a:active { color: #FFCC00; text-decoration: none}

img {
	border-style: none;
}

hr {
	margin: 25px;
	height: 1px;
	background-color: #397913;
	border-width: 0;
}

/* @end */

.side_support { color: #fff; font-size: 11px; font-family: "Lucida Grande", Arial, sans-serif}

.side_support_hi { font-family: Tahoma, Arial; font-size: 11px; line-height: 14px; font-weight: normal; color: #FDED02 }

.copy { font-size: 9px; color: #B7C8B4 }

.menu_bot { font-size: 11px; font-weight: bold; color: #FFFFFF }

.heading { font-family: "Trebuchet MS", Tahoma, "Lucida Grande"; font-size: 15px; font-weight: bold; color: #FFCC00; text-transform: uppercase }

.subhead { font-family: "Trebuchet MS", Tahoma, "Lucida Grande"; font-size: 13px; font-weight: bold; color: #FFFFFF }

#maintable {
background:url(images/main/main_back-repeat.gif) repeat-y;
width:779px;
}

#home_bottomlinks{
padding-top:15px;
color:#FFCC00;
	text-transform: uppercase;
	font: 9px "Franklin Gothic Medium", sans-serif;
}

#footer_copy{
	width:779px;
color:#FFFFFF;
margin-top:10px;
	font: 10px/200% "Franklin Gothic Medium", sans-serif;
}

#home_support p{
	padding-right: 12px;
	padding-left: 10px;
	color: white;
	font: 9px/11pt "Lucida Grande", Arial, sans-serif;
}

/* @group Content */

#content_back {
	background: #1b5613 url(images/content/content_repeat.gif) repeat-y;
}

#content_top {
	background: url(images/content/content_header.jpg) no-repeat;

}

#content_bottom {
	background: url(images/content/content_bottom.jpg) no-repeat 0 bottom;
}

#content_copy {
	color: white;
	font: 8pt"Lucida Grande", Arial, sans-serif;
	padding: 88px 50px 35px 30px;
}

#content_copy p{
	padding-bottom: 8px;
}

#content_copy li{
	padding-bottom: 5px;
}

.headerimg {
	margin-top: 25px;
}



/* @end */

/* @group Bottom_Menu */

.menu_bot a:link { font-weight: normal; color: #FFCC00; text-decoration: underline }

.menu_bot a:visited { font-weight: normal; color: #FFCC00; text-decoration: underline }

.menu_bot a:hover { font-weight: normal; color: #FFCC00; text-decoration: none }

.menu_bot a:active { font-weight: normal; color: #FFCC00; text-decoration: underline }



/* @end */

/* @group Promotions Page */

/* @group Promo Tables */

.promotable{
}

.promotable hr {
	margin: 25px;
	height: 1px;
	background-color: #397913;
	border-width: 0;
}

.promolinkstable th{
	color: white;
	font: bold 12pt "Lucida Grande", Arial, sans-serif;
	background-color: #387912;
}

.promolinkstable td ul{
	color: white;
	font: bold 8pt "Lucida Grande", Arial, sans-serif;
	list-style-image: url(images/promotions/chip.jpg);
	text-shadow: #000000 0px 1px 0;
	list-style-position: outside;
}

.promolinkstable td li{
	margin-bottom: 5px;
}

.promolinkstable li a {
	text-decoration: none;
	color: white;
}

.promolinkstable li a:active {
	text-decoration: none;
	color: white;
}

.promolinkstable li a:visited {
	text-decoration: none;
	color: white;
}

.promolinkstable li a:hover {
	text-decoration: none;
	color: #FFCC00;
}



/* @end */


/* @group header */


.promo_header {
	color: #FFCC33;
	font: bold 18px "Lucida Grande", Arial, sans-serif;
}

.promo_header a{
	color: #FFCC33;
	text-decoration: none;
}
.promo_subheader {
	color: #FFCC33;
	font: bold 10pt "Lucida Grande", Arial, sans-serif;
	margin-top: -12pt;
}

.promo_subheader a{
	color: #FFCC33;
	text-decoration: none;
}

/* @end */

/* @group copy */

.promo_copy {
	color: #FFFFFF;
	font: 8pt "Lucida Grande", Arial, sans-serif;
}

/* @end */

/* @group promo_clickformore */

.promo_clickformore {
	color: #FFFFFF;
	font: bold 10pt "Lucida Grande", Arial, sans-serif;
}

.promo_clickformore a{
	color: #FFCC33;
	text-decoration: none;
}

.promo_clickformore a:active{
	color: #FFCC33;

	text-decoration: none;
}

.promo_clickformore a:visited{
	color: #FFCC33;
	text-decoration: none;
}

.promo_clickformore a:hover{
	color: #FFCC33;
	text-decoration: underline;
}

/* @end */

/* @group promo_backtotop */

.promo_backtotop {
	color: #FFFFFF;
	font: bold 8pt "Lucida Grande", Arial, sans-serif;
	margin-top: -10pt;
}

.promo_backtotop a{
	color: #FFCC33;
	text-decoration: none;
}

.promo_backtotop a:active{
	color: #FFCC33;

	text-decoration: none;
}

.promo_backtotop a:visited{
	color: #FFCC33;
	text-decoration: none;
}

.promo_backtotop a:hover{
	color: #FFCC33;
	text-decoration: underline;
}

/* @end */



/* @end */

/* @group Promotion Pages */

.promopage_header {
	color: #FFCC33;
	font: bold 20px "Lucida Grande", Arial, sans-serif;
	text-align: center;
}

.promopage_header a{
	color: #FFCC33;
	text-decoration: none;
}
.promopage_subheader {
	color: #FFCC33;
	font: bold 10pt "Lucida Grande", Arial, sans-serif;
	text-align: center;
}

.promopage_subheader a{
	color: #FFCC33;
	text-decoration: none;
}

.promopage_tagline {
	color: white;
	font: bold 18px "Lucida Grande", Arial, sans-serif;
	text-align: center;
}

.promopage_smallprint {
	color: white;
	font-size: 8pt;
	font-weight: normal;
	font-style: normal;
	text-align: center;
}

.promolist{
	color: white;
	font: 8pt "Lucida Grande", Arial, sans-serif;
	list-style-position: outside;
}

.promolist li{
	margin-bottom: 5px;
}

/* @end */

/* @group Preview */

.previewtable td ul{
	color: white;
	font: bold 12px "Lucida Grande", Arial, sans-serif;
	list-style-image: url(images/promotions/chip.jpg);
	text-shadow: #000000 0px 1px 0;
	list-style-position: outside;
}

.previewtable td li{
	margin-bottom: 5px;
}

.previewtable li a {
	text-decoration: none;
	color: white;
}

.previewtable li a:active {
	text-decoration: none;
	color: white;
}

.previewtable li a:visited {
	text-decoration: none;
	color: white;
}

.previewtable li a:hover {
	text-decoration: none;
	color: #FFCC00;
}



/* @end */

/* @group Sidetable */

.side_table th{
	color: #FFCC00;
	font: bold 10pt "Lucida Grande", Arial, sans-serif;
	text-align: left;
	padding-left: 16px;
}

.side_table td ul{
	color: white;
	font:  8pt "Lucida Grande", Arial, sans-serif;
	list-style-position: outside;
}

.side_table td li{
	margin-bottom: 5px;
	margin-right: 5px;
}

.side_table li a {
	text-decoration: none;
	color: white;
}

.side_table li a:active {
	text-decoration: none;
	color: white;
}

.side_table li a:visited {
	text-decoration: none;
	color: white;
}

.side_table li a:hover {
	text-decoration: none;
	color: #FFCC00;
}


/* @end */

/* @group News */

.news_heading { 
font-family: "Trebuchet MS", Tahoma, "Lucida Grande"; 
font-size: 15px; 
font-weight: bold; color: #FFCC00; 
text-transform: uppercase }

.news_subhead { 
font-family: "Trebuchet MS", Tahoma, "Lucida Grande"; 
font-size: 11px; 
font-weight: bold; 
color: #FFFFFF }

.news_small { 
color: #FFFFFF;
text-transform: none;
	font: normal 11px "Trebuchet MS", Tahoma, "Lucida Grande";
}

.news_normal {
	font-weight: normal;
	font-style: normal;
}

/* @end */

/* @group Popups */

#oncepopborder {
	border: 4px solid #dcd8d2;
	width: 306px;
	margin: 0;
	padding: 0;
}

#oncepop {
	position: absolute;
	top: -440px;
	left: 20px;
	z-index: 100;
	width: 314px;
	margin: 0;
	padding: 0;
	display: block;
}

#oncepop img, #oncepop table{
	margin: 0;
	padding: 0;
}



/* @end */

